Comparing Nutrients in 300 calories Oil Roasted Sunflower SeedsVS Boiled Spinach with Salt
Weight per 300 calories
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ds
50.7g
Boiled Spinach with Salt
1304g
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 25.7 times more energy per 100g than Boiled Spinach with Salt. It has very high energy density when compared to other foods. Boiled and Drained Spinach with Salt having very low energy density.

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ds vs Boiled Spinach with Salt:
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 1.9 times more Vitamin B5 than Boiled Spinach with Salt.
While 300 kcal of Boiled and Drained Spinach with Salt contain more Vitamin A, 7.6 times more Vitamin B1, 21.7 times more Vitamin B2, 3.1 times more Vitamin B3, 7.9 times more Vitamin B6, 16.1 times more Vitamin B9, 229.3 times more Vitamin C, 1.5 times more Vitamin E and 4098.3 times more Vitamin K than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in C and Vitamin K
Both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els as well as Boiled and Drained Spinach with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 300 calories.
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ds vs Boiled Spinach with Salt:
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 2 times more Selenium than Boiled Spinach with Salt.
While 300 kcal of Boiled and Drained Spinach with Salt contain 40.2 times more Calcium, 2.5 times more Copper, 21.5 times more Iron, 17.6 times more Magnesium, 11.6 times more Manganese, 1.3 times more Phosphorus, 24.8 times more Potassium, 2625.4 times more Sodium, 3.8 times more Zinc and 1524.5 times more Water than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have 7.7 times more Fat, 6.4 times more Saturated Fat and 78.2 times more Omega 6 than Boiled Spinach with Salt.
While 300 kcal of Boiled and Drained Spinach with Salt contain 29.2 times more Omega 3, 4.2 times more Carbohydrate, 3.6 times more Sugars, 5.8 times more Fiber and 3.8 times more Protein than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els.
Both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ds and Boiled Spinach with Salt offer comparable quantities of Energy per 300 calories.
300 calories of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
300 calories of Boiled Spinach with Salt prov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6
